Researchers in Israel have conducted a study showing that increased hospital load due to rising co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) cases resulted in higher COVID-19-related mortality, despite hospitals not exceeding their defined threshold for meeting patients’ treatment needs.
The team attributes the increased mortality rate to the rapid influx of new cases over short time periods leaving healthcare systems overwhelmed and under-resourced.
